TROLLEY-CATCHER.
SPECIFICATION forming part of Letters Patent No. 532,477, dated January 15, 1895.
Application fled May 26, 1894. Serial No. 512.566' (N0 modem cation.
Our invention is in the nature of attachments for electric car trolleys adapted to regulate the movements of the trolley and automatically control it and prevent it from flying up and kbreakin g or damaging the goose necks,I feed arms, dac., when such trolley becomes disengaged from the wire; and such invention has primarily for its object to provide attachments of this character of a Simple and inexpensive structure, which can easily be manipulated and which will positively and effectively serve for the intended purposes.
It also has for its object to provide attachments of this kind, which will automatically serve to pull the trolley arm down from engagement with the Wire and Supports, as the Wheel jumps therefrom, and which can be quickly adjusted by the motorman to reset the wheel against the wire.
With other minor objects in View, which hereinafter will be referred to, the invention consists in such novel combination and peculiar arrangement of parts as will hereinafter be iirst described in detait and then specifically pointed out in the appended claims, reference being had to the accompanying drawings, in which- Figure lis a perspective view of a portion of an electric motor car equipped with our improved attachments, the trolley'arm being shown tripped and pulled down from the wire, in dotted lines. Fig. 2 is a face View of the attachments, the parts being set to their normal position. Fig. 3 illustrates the parts at their tripped position; and Fig. 4 is a horizontal cross section on the line 4 4 Fig. 3.
Referring to the accompanying drawings, in which like lettersindicate Similar parts in all the gures, A indicates the dash board of the car, to which is secured a boxing or guide member B,'provided with a' slot or groove way b, disposed centrally nearly its entire length from the top to the bottom, in which is held to slide a weight C, in practice, sufficiently large to overcome the upward spring tension of the trolley arm to pull it down from contact with the Wire, when released, for a 'purpose presently described. This Weight, which may have guide grooves, or dovetail connections, or be otherwise held in the slot or Way b, has a handle member c whereby itcan be conveniently drawn upward, when desired, and which also serves as a detent or lock to hold it to its elevated position. This Weight has a hook or eye portion c to which is connected a cord D the upper end of Which has a snap hook d, which engages an eye c, at the lower end of a cord or pole E, the upper end of which has a pivotal or swivel connection F with the trolley arm G, as shown most clearly in Fig. l, such pole being guided in a bracket H secured on the top of the car as shown.
It will be noticed that the normal relation of thetrolley arm, the pole E, the Weight C, and cord D, is such', that the cord D will be held somewhat slack. The object in thus arranging the several parts is, to provide for automatically setting the said parts to hold the trolley arm down after it becomes disen` gaged from the wire. To this end a spring catch member J is secured in the box with its detent or lock portion j normally projected over the groove or way b, and in engagement with the underside of the handle c such portionj being connected with one end ofa bell crank or trip lever K, the opposite end ofY which is connected to a cord L, the upper end of which has a snap connection with the ring e, such cord L being normally held taut as shown.
So far as described it will be readily seen, that in case the trolley should slip off the wire, the spring tension on the arm will serve to immediately throw the wheel above the Wire. In doing so the pole E will draw on the cord L and thereby rock the trip lever K, and in consequence pull the spring member from under the handle member ofthe Weight, which` being thus released drops to the bottom of the way b and as it descends it draws on the cord D and pole E and pulls the trolley arm down to the position shown in dotted lines in Fig. 1.
It should be stated that in practice a duplicate set of attachments, (one on each dash too Kil
board) is provided, and as the brackets have spring lingers to more securely guide the pole in position, it follows, that, when the trolley is shifted at the end of the car route, and the cords at one end are disconnected from kthe pole F, such pole can be quickly drawn out of the guide Il and moved with the trolley arm around to the other end of the car, adj usted in the opposite bracket and connected with the attachments at such other end.
